Just so you guys don't get the impression that my cigar reviewing is always so serious. ;) I'm also working on a "ghetto series" exploration of the wild and wooly world of blunts, cheroots, and other mass-market sub-premium smokes. Here is the first set consisting of three White Owl Blunts Xtra Tubos. From left to right are Pineapple, Strawberry, and Grape. They have homogenized tobacco leaf wrappers and are short filler (I'm pretty sure but I will be dissecting) and are beyond flavored. Just opening one tube releases the ultrastrong scent of stylized fruit all over my basement. In terms of the strength of the scent, they are a league beyond my humble Moontrance.
